The Allen-Bradley 1769-ADN, also cataloged as the 1769-ADN DeviceNet Adapter Module, operates as a dedicated hardware component for fieldbus network integration within CompactLogix expansion platforms. The unit bridges high-speed serial DeviceNet communications to local Compact I/O modules across a maximum capacity of 30 modules per bank assembly. Configured to manage system I/O updates with a maximum heat dissipation profile of 4.7 W, the module executes deterministic real-time backplane data transfer while maintaining galvanic isolation verified at 710 VDC for 1 minute.

Backplane Bus Communication & Deterministic Processing

The Allen-Bradley 1769-ADN manages backplane bus communication velocity across local Compact I/O banks by translating incoming DeviceNet serial CAN frames into native parallel backplane protocol structures. Firmware flash compatibility ensures synchronized scan execution between remote trunkline scanners and connected input/output channels. The adapter scales high-density I/O configurations while strictly enforcing power supply distance ratings—allowing placement no further than 4 modules (Series A) or 5 modules (Series B) away from the 1769 power supply to maintain stable backplane signal integrity and avoid timing dropouts.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How is the maximum distance between the 1769-ADN adapter and the system power supply determined?

A: The distance is dictated by the Power Supply Distance Rating of the module series. Series A adapters must be located within 4 slots of the 1769 power supply, whereas Series B adapters allow installation up to 5 slots away to prevent excessive backplane logic voltage drops.

Q: What network trunkline cable is specified for connecting the 1769-ADN to a DeviceNet network?

A: Allen-Bradley recommends using 1485C-P1-Cxxx class thick or thin DeviceNet cable assemblies (as detailed in Allen-Bradley publication DN-2.5) to ensure proper network impedance and baud rate transmission performance.

Field Installation Guidelines

  1. Power Isolation: Ensure all primary power sources and DeviceNet trunkline power supplies are de-energized prior to mounting or removing the 1769-ADN module to avoid electrical arcs or network disruption.
  2. DIN Rail / Panel Mounting: Lock the adapter securely onto a 35 mm DIN rail or secure it via panel mounting tabs. Verify that side tongue-and-groove interconnects are fully engaged with adjacent 1769 I/O modules or power supplies before snapping down the locking latches.
  3. ESD & Grounding Safeguards: Adhere to IEC 61000-4-2 limits (6 kV contact, 8 kV air discharge) by using ESD wrist straps during installation. Fasten the ground terminal pin securely to the metal panel backplate to maintain compliance with CISPR 11 Class A emission standards.
  4. Network Wiring & Termination: Connect the 5-pin removable DeviceNet connector ensuring color-coded signal lead alignment (V+, CAN H, Shield, CAN L, V-). Install 121-ohm, 1/4-watt metal film terminating resistors across the CAN H and CAN L lines at both physical ends of the main DeviceNet trunkline.
